Govt Asks Netizens Not To Spread Rumours About GST Law Giving Exemptions To Some Religions

The Government of India has appealed to the people not to circulate wrong messages on the social media that spread disaffection among religions. A PIB release has clarified that no distinction is made in the GST Law on any provision based on religion.

The release said: Some messages are being spread in the social media that the temple trusts have to pay the GST while the churches and mosques are exempt. This is completely untrue because no distinction is made in the GST Law on any provision based on religion."
